More information on the steel used for the Badlands Bowie
 
Carbon steel; iron infused with carbon for strength, first flickered into use around 1200 BCE in the hands of Anatolian blacksmiths, with the Hittites forging crude blades that outmatched bronze. By 500 BCE, India’s wootz steel, a high-carbon marvel, was dazzling warriors, its secrets rippling through Damascus smiths by the early centuries CE. Fast forward to Europe’s Middle Ages—around the 13th century—and smiths were dialing in carbon levels closer to 0.8-1.0%, crafting swords and knives with a balance of hardness and flexibility. The 1085 we know today sits in that sweet spot, but it wasn’t named or standardized until the industrial age.
 
The real leap came in the 19th century—think 1850s—when steelmaking went from art to science. The Bessemer process blew open mass production, and by the late 1800s, carbon steels like 1085 were being refined in American forges for tools, blades, and machinery. The AISI system locked in the "1085" tag around 1912, giving us the precise recipe—0.80-0.93% carbon, traces of manganese, and pure iron grit. That’s when 1085, as we’d recognize it, hit the scene, prized for its edge-holding bite and forge-friendly temper, perfect for a Bowie like Jim Bowie’s.
 
So, while carbon steel’s been around since the Bronze Age collapsed, 1085 as a distinct alloy crystallized in the industrial boom—late 19th century, early 20th—when steel became less guesswork and more gospel. Jim Bowie’s blade might’ve danced close to it in spirit, but the Badlands Western Bowie Knife wields the modern echo of that ancient craft.
